Frequently Asked Questions About Cabinet Installers in Castroville

Get answers to common questions about cabinet installers services in Castroville, Texas.

1What is the typical cost range for professional cabinet installation in Castroville, and what factors influence the price?

In Castroville and the surrounding Medina County area, professional cabinet installation typically ranges from $1,500 to $5,000+, heavily dependent on project scope. Key cost factors include the cabinet material (solid wood vs. laminate), whether you're doing a full kitchen, bathroom, or just an update, and the complexity of the layout. Local labor rates and the need for any structural modifications to your existing home, common in older Castroville properties, will also significantly impact the final quote.

2How does the South Texas climate, with its high humidity and heat, affect cabinet selection and installation?

Castroville's humidity and heat require careful material selection to prevent warping, swelling, or glue failure. We strongly recommend moisture-resistant materials like marine-grade plywood for boxes, and stable hardwoods or high-quality thermofoil for doors and faces. Proper installation must also account for expansion by leaving appropriate gaps, and we ensure kitchens are well-ventilated to mitigate the constant humidity, which is higher than in drier parts of Texas.

3Do I need a permit for a cabinet installation project in Castroville, Texas?

For a straightforward cabinet replacement where you are not moving plumbing, electrical, or altering walls, a permit is usually not required in Castroville. However, if your installation is part of a larger remodel that involves changing the kitchen's footprint, relocating utilities, or modifying load-bearing walls, you will likely need a permit from the City of Castroville's Development Services. A reputable local installer will know these regulations and can advise you accordingly.

4What should I look for when choosing a cabinet installer in the Castroville area?

Prioritize local providers with verifiable references and physical addresses, as they understand regional styles and common structural quirks of area homes. Ensure they are licensed and insured to protect your property. Ask to see a portfolio of completed projects and specifically inquire about their experience with handling the substrate and moisture issues prevalent in our climate. Checking reviews from other Medina County residents is also invaluable.

5What is a realistic timeline for a kitchen cabinet installation in my home?

For a standard kitchen, the physical installation typically takes 2-4 days for a skilled crew, assuming all cabinets and materials are on-site. However, the total project timeline must account for the lead time for cabinet manufacturing/delivery (often 4-8 weeks) and potential delays during Castroville's peak remodeling seasons (spring and early fall). We also recommend scheduling installations outside of the rainy summer months if possible, to avoid moisture-related issues during delivery and fitting.
